SEM0502 Land Search

SEM0502
Provides the skills and knowledge to assist Police in conducting land searches in all types of terrain in both rural and urban areas. Most searches are undertaken for missing or injured people however, volunteers also assist Police looking for criminal evidence, so the course also covers how to preserve an incident scene to ensure evidence is not compromised.

Introduction:

The SEM0502 Land Search course has been developed to provide QFES members with the knowledge and skills to undertake land search operations and protect and preserve an incident scene. The course has been written to satisfy QFES organisational requirements and to reflect the relevant nationally accredited units PUASAR027
Undertake land search rescue and PUALAW001 Protect and preserve incident scene.

Target Audience:

SES Staff and Volunteer Members

Learning Outcomes:

  • PUASAR027 Undertake land search rescue
  • PUALAW001 Protect and preserve incident scene

Learning Methods:

This course is conducted via a Face-to-Face workshop. It is approximately 11.5 hours in duration

Program Benefits:

  • prepare for a land search
  • participate in a land search
  • secure and preserve a scene
  • record and report details of an incident scene
  • complete search stand-down procedures
  • maintain personal and team safety
